Description

The  Bently Nevada 330103‑00‑60‑05‑02‑05 is a variant of the 3300/3300 XL series eddy‐current (non‐contact) proximity probes / transducers manufactured by Bently Nevada .

These probes are used to measure the gap between a conductive target (typically a rotating shaft or a reference ring) and the probe tip, and convert that gap into a voltage output.

This allows monitoring of shaft displacement, static or dynamic (vibration) behavior, axial position, or reference (Keyphasor) signals.

Q1: What is the functional principle of this probe?
A: The probe is an eddy‐current sensor: when mounted facing a conductive target, the probe tip generates a small electromagnetic

field. The distance (gap) between the tip and the target changes the impedance and thus the output voltage.

Within its linear range, the output is directly proportional to gap change. This allows measurement

of both static position (gap offset) and dynamic vibration (gap oscillations).



Q2: What is the “linear range” and how do I know if the probe is suitable for my shaft size/gap?
A: The linear range is the operating distance over which the output reliably varies proportionally to the gap.

For the 3300 XL 8 mm system, a typical linear range is ~60 mils (≈1.5 mm) for the NSv version. 

 You must ensure your probe mounting and target gap fall within this range (and typically near

the middle of the range for best dynamic sensitivity). If gap is too large or target is

 too small, measurement may be less accurate or saturated.



Q3: Can I mix this probe with other brands or non‐Bently drivers or cables?
A: While technically possible, it’s strongly recommended to use the full system compatibility:

probe + extension cable + driver from the same series to ensure proper calibration, linearity, and

 compliance with standards. The datasheet emphasises that the system is calibrated as a

complete unit and back‐compatible within the 3300/3300 XL series.  If you

 mix components, you may introduce error, degrade

performance, or void certification.
